There is no direct connection from Grand Marais to Chicago. However, you can take the shuttle to Duluth International Airport, walk to Duluth International Airport (DLH) airport, fly to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D), walk to O'Hare, then take the subway to Jackson-Blue. Alternatively, you can take a shuttle from Grand Marais to Chicago Union Station via Duluth International Airport, Airport Terminal, Duluth, St. Paul, and St. Paul-Minneapolis in around 15h 39m.
